Abstract :
INTRODUCTION: We aimed to compare apical canal transportation of extracted teeth and two types of simulated resin blocks. MATERIALS and METHODS: Mesiobuccal root of extracted maxillary molars, high hardness simulated resin blocks (Knoop hardness=40) and low hardness simulated resin blocks (Knoop hardness=22) were prepared with K-files using step-back technique (n=15 canals in each group). Double exposure radiographic technique was used for extracted teeth. Simulated resin blocks were stabilized and scanned before and after preparation. Pre and post-preparation pictures were superimposed and apical transportation was measured. The data were analyzed statistically using ANOVA and Tukey HSD tests. RESULTS: There was no significant difference in apical canal transportation between extracted teeth and high hardness resin blocks (P>0.05). Low hardness resin blocks showed more apical transportation than the other groups (P<0.05). CONCLUSION: Under the conditions of this study, apical canal transportation for extracted teeth and high hardness simulated resin blocks were similar.
